Covid: 11 fresh cases, tally 169 in UP's Jaunpur

| @indiablooms | May 30, 2020, at 03:06 pm

Jaunpur/UNI: With 11 more people testing positive in the last 24 hours, the number of people infected by the Novel Coronavirus rose to 169 in this Uttar Pradesh district.

District Magistrate Dinesh Kumar Singh on Saturday here said that 11 more migrants tested positive in the past 24 hours and all of them have returned from Gujarat and Mumbai.

Now, the total number of cases in the district have increased to 169, out of which 25 have recovered and were discharged.

Three other people had succumbed to the infection even before reaching the hospital.

A total of 141 active patients are currently undergoing treatment in the district.

The DM said that reports of 118 samples were obtained on Friday night and all of them tested negative.

The reports of 11 migrants were also received who tested positive. 275 new samples have been taken and including them, 3893 individuals have so far been tested in the district, out of which 2,745 reports have been obtained.

Results of 1,094 samples are awaited.
